MSF is one of the top actors in addressing the global medical needs of the world, especially in emergency situations. When the earthquake hit Port au Prince on Jan 12, MSF sent an additional 70 volunteers within 48 hours to their existing project of 300 employees. Their ability to mobilize and respond quickly to situations is due to support of individuals who recognize and believe in what they are doing.
